Nancy Massotto is a Holistic Parenting expert, Executive Director of the Holistic Moms Network, and dedicated advocate for holistic medicine and green living. She is the mother of two boys, both born at home. Before embarking on her journey into motherhood, she earned her Ph.D. in political science from the University of Maryland, specializing in gender studies, women's issues, and international affairs. She also holds Master's degrees from George Washington University, Elliot School of International Affairs, and the University of Maryland. Dr. Massotto has lectured at several universities on gender studies, international relations, and women's issues, including at American University and George Washington University. Taking time out to start her family, Dr. Massotto founded the Holistic Moms Network, Inc. to help parents interested in natural and holistic living to find support and resources for their parenting choices. She has guided the organization from its local origins into a national non-profit network with more than 130 chapters across the United States and Canada. She is a dedicated advocate for natural living and holistic medicine. Dr. Massotto currently resides in New Jersey with her husband, Mike, two sons, and two rescued dogs. (
